From Venetian to Gypsum: Modern Plaster Choices

Throughout history , building materials evolved dramatically. Starting with the rich tradition of stucco plaster, craftsmanship progressed through centuries, ultimately leading to a range of modern options. Today's builders can choose from diverse types read more of plaster, each with its own unique properties and applications. Gypsum plaster, known for its workability and fire resistance, has emerged as a staple in construction. In conjunction with gypsum, other advanced materials offer improved durability, sound insulation, and even mold resistance.

Achieving a Seamless Finish with Expert Plastering Techniques

A flawless plaster finish demands meticulous attention to detail and an understanding of proficient plastering techniques.

Begin by ensuring your surface is properly prepared, free from any imperfections or debris. Subsequently, apply a coat of undercoat to create a smooth surface. When applying the mortar, work in small patches and smooth the edges seamlessly.

Utilizing the right tools, such as a trowel and flattening tool, will help you achieve a uniform texture.

Don't forget to allow each coat to cure completely before moving on to the next. Finally, coat with a final layer of plaster for a professional-looking finish that will elevate your walls.

The Ultimate Guide to Interior Plaster Applications

Interior plastering functions a crucial role in creating stunning and durable wall and ceiling surfaces. Whether you're undertaking a complete renovation or simply wanting to refresh your space, understanding the fundamentals of plaster application is essential. This guide will provide you with a detailed understanding of the process involved, from preparation to finish.

First selecting the appropriate type of plaster for your project, considering factors such as wall structure and desired aesthetic. Next, meticulously prepare the surface by fixing any imperfections and applying a suitable undercoating layer.

Apply the plaster using a trowel or hawk, ensuring an even and consistent spread across the entire surface. Allow each coat to cure completely before installing the next. Finally, sand the dried plaster smooth and apply paint for a flawless look.

Here are some essential tips for achieving successful interior plaster applications:

* Use high-quality mortar and tools.

* Maintain a consistent humidity during the application process.

* Work in small sections to ensure proper coverage and drying.

* Be mindful of details, such as corners and edges.

By following these guidelines and practicing patience, you can achieve a beautifully finished plaster surface that will enhance the appeal of your interior space.
